Active Job Listings

Log in or register to subscribe to email updates for this job search

Find by Job Title: | Back to full List

4 results
Senior Software Engineer, Game Services
Blizzard Entertainment - Austin, TX, USA
8d
Senior Software Engineer, Game Services
Blizzard Entertainment - Austin, TX, USA
9d
Principal Technical Program Manager
Twitch - Seattle, WA, USA
29d
Technical Director, Platform Security
Blizzard Entertainment - Austin, TX, USA
47d
Previous Next